52破解 H5 棋牌源码,从技术角度解析游戏源码的破解方法52破解 h5棋牌源码
本文目录导读:
好,我现在要帮用户写一篇关于“52破解 H5 棋牌源码”的文章,我需要理解用户的需求,用户给了一个标题和一个要求,文章内容至少要1016个字,看起来用户可能是一个开发者,或者是对游戏开发感兴趣的人,他们想要了解如何破解H5棋牌游戏的源码,可能是为了学习、研究或者开发自己的游戏。 我得确定文章的结构,技术文章需要一个清晰的结构,包括引言、背景、技术细节、实现步骤、注意事项以及结论,这样可以让读者容易理解。 我需要考虑用户可能的需求,他们可能想知道如何破解H5游戏,可能是因为他们想学习源码,或者想开发自己的游戏,但遇到了困难,文章不仅要介绍破解的方法,还要提供详细的步骤和注意事项,帮助用户避免常见的错误。 我得思考如何组织内容,引言部分可以介绍H5游戏的普及和破解的重要性,背景部分可以解释H5技术的特点,以及游戏源码的保护措施,技术细节部分可以深入讨论H5框架的特性,如跨浏览器兼容性、动态数据交换等,以及这些特性如何影响源码的破解难度。 实现步骤部分需要详细列出,比如如何获取源码、分析框架结构、使用工具进行破解、测试和优化,每个步骤都要有具体的例子和说明,这样用户可以跟着操作。 注意事项部分要提醒用户遵守法律,尊重版权,避免滥用破解技术,可以提到源码保护的未来趋势,比如使用加密技术,以增加破解的难度。 结论部分要总结破解的好处和风险,鼓励用户在合法范围内使用技术,同时强调技术发展的趋势。 我需要确保文章内容不少于1016个字,所以每个部分都要详细展开,在分析H5框架时,可以提到Flexbox、JavaScript、DOM等技术,以及它们如何影响源码的结构。 在实现步骤中,要详细说明如何使用工具,比如JavaScript逆向工具,如何分析DOM结构,如何处理动态数据交换等,这些都需要具体的指导,帮助用户一步步完成破解。 检查文章是否符合用户的要求,确保没有遗漏任何关键点,比如法律和道德方面的内容,以及源码保护的未来趋势,这样,文章不仅技术全面,还具备实用性和指导性。
随着互联网技术的飞速发展,H5技术作为一种跨浏览器的前端技术,被广泛应用于游戏、应用、网站等领域,H5技术凭借其轻量级、跨平台的特点,成为开发者们追逐的目标,随着技术的不断深入,游戏源码的保护措施也在不断加强,如何破解H5源码成为了开发者们面临的一个难题,本文将从技术角度出发,详细解析如何破解52 H5 棋牌源码,并探讨源码保护的趋势。
H5技术的特性与源码保护
H5(HyperText Markup Language)是一种基于HTML5的轻量级前端技术,旨在简化跨浏览器开发,H5技术的核心优势在于其轻量级和跨平台特性,这使得开发者可以使用少量代码实现复杂的跨平台应用,这也为源码的保护提供了便利。
随着技术的发展,游戏源码的保护措施也在不断加强,许多游戏在发布后会采用加密技术、动态数据交换(Dynamic Data Exchange, DDE)等技术来保护源码,这些技术使得源码的破解难度大幅增加,但并非绝对不可行。
52 H5 棋牌源码的分析
为了破解52 H5 棋牌源码,我们需要先了解其技术架构,52 H5 棋牌是一款基于H5技术的扑克游戏,其源码通常包含以下几个部分:
- 前端代码:包括HTML、CSS和JavaScript,用于构建游戏界面和逻辑。
- 后端代码:通常采用Node.js或Python等后端框架,用于处理游戏逻辑和数据交互。
- 动态数据交换(DDE):H5技术的核心特性之一,用于在前端和后端之间动态交换数据。
通过分析这些部分,我们可以更好地理解源码的结构,并制定破解策略。
破解52 H5 棋牌源码的步骤
获取源码
破解源码的第一步是获取源码,开发者可以通过以下方式获取源码:
- 公开开源项目:如果52 H5 棋牌是一个公开的开源项目,开发者可以通过GitHub、GitLab等平台获取源码。
- 联系开发者:如果无法通过公开渠道获取源码,可以尝试联系开发者或游戏公司寻求帮助。
- 付费获取:如果源码无法公开,开发者可能需要支付费用才能获取。
分析源码结构
在获取源码后,我们需要对源码进行分析,了解其架构和逻辑,这可以通过以下方式实现:
- 静态分析:使用浏览器工具(如Chrome DevTools)查看源码的结构和代码行。
- 动态分析:使用逆向工具(如Radare2)分析JavaScript和assembly代码。
利用H5框架特性
H5技术的特性为我们破解源码提供了便利,以下是利用这些特性进行破解的技巧:
- Flexbox布局:H5框架支持Flexbox布局,可以通过分析布局样式来推断元素的位置和大小。
- JavaScript逆向:H5框架的JavaScript代码通常较为简洁,可以通过逆向工具分析事件处理逻辑。
- 动态数据交换(DDE):DDE是H5技术的核心特性之一,可以通过分析DDE接口来获取后端数据。
使用逆向工具
逆向工具是破解H5源码的核心工具,以下是常用的逆向工具及其使用方法:
- Radare2:一款功能强大的逆向工具,支持分析JavaScript、assembly和DDE接口。
- GDB:一款调试工具,可以用于分析动态加载的代码。
- IDA Pro:一款专业的逆向工具,支持分析C语言和assembly代码。
通过使用这些工具,我们可以更好地理解源码的逻辑,并提取出我们需要的信息。
测试与优化
在分析源码后,我们需要通过测试来验证我们的破解方法,以下是测试的步骤:
- 单元测试:对每个模块进行单独测试,确保其功能正常。
- 集成测试:将各个模块集成测试,确保整个系统功能正常。
- 性能测试:测试源码的性能,确保其符合预期。
通过测试,我们可以发现并修复源码中的问题。
注意事项
在破解H5源码时,需要注意以下几点:
- 遵守法律与道德:破解源码属于非法行为,可能会违反相关法律,请在合法范围内进行开发和破解。
- 尊重版权:游戏源码的保护是为了尊重游戏的作者和版权,请勿将破解源码用于商业用途。
- 技术趋势:随着技术的发展,源码保护措施也会越来越严格,加密技术和动态数据交换可能会更加复杂,破解难度也会相应增加。
源码保护的未来趋势
随着技术的发展,源码保护的难度也在不断增加,以下是源码保护的未来趋势:
- 加密技术:游戏源码可能会采用更加复杂的加密技术,使得破解难度大幅增加。
- 微服务架构:微服务架构的兴起,使得源码的模块化开发更加普遍,破解难度也会相应增加。
- 零信任架构:零信任架构的兴起,使得源码的访问和运行需要更多的验证和授权,破解难度也会相应增加。
破解52 H5 棋牌源码是一项具有挑战性的技术任务,但并非不可能,通过分析源码的架构、利用H5框架的特性以及使用逆向工具,我们可以更好地理解源码的逻辑,并制定有效的破解策略,破解源码并非一件简单的事情,需要我们遵守法律、尊重版权,并在技术发展的趋势下,采取更加谨慎的态度。
随着技术的不断进步,源码保护的难度也会不断增加,我们只有不断提升自己的技术能力,才能更好地应对未来的挑战。
52破解 H5 棋牌源码,从技术角度解析游戏源码的破解方法52破解 h5棋牌源码,




发表评论